Three UK airports hit by cyber-attack with data of 8.7m customers accessed

Company that runs Manchester, Stansted and East Midlands hubs says passenger safety is unaffected

Business live – latest updates

Manchester, London Stansted and East Midlands airports have been hit by a cyber-attack in which hackers accessed the data of about 8.7 million customers.

The incident involved data related to “car park, lounge and fast-track bookings and in-airport wifi sign-ups”, and the hackers obtained email addresses, phone numbers, vehicle registration numbers and postcodes, said Manchester Airports Group (MAG), which operates the three hubs.
